Structured cabling techniques for laptop networks usually depend on twisted-pair copper cables. These cables include eight particular person wires, twisted in pairs to mitigate electromagnetic interference. To make sure constant connectivity, these wire pairs are organized in response to particular shade conventions, often called T568A and T568B. T568A orders the pairs as inexperienced/white, inexperienced, orange/white, blue, blue/white, orange, brown/white, and brown. T568B makes use of a barely completely different order: orange/white, orange, inexperienced/white, blue, blue/white, inexperienced, brown/white, and brown. Cables wired utilizing the identical commonplace at each ends are referred to as “straight-through” and are used for typical community connections. “Crossover” cables, with completely different requirements at every finish, have been beforehand used for direct computer-to-computer connections however are much less frequent with fashionable community tools.
